In June 2002, the NSW Ministry for the Arts completed the purchase of the Carriage and Blacksmith Workshops at the Eveleigh Rail Yards site. Soon after, a construction project on the site commenced under the name of Carriageworks.
432:
Carriageworks is Australia's largest contemporary multi-arts centre. It has been supported by the New South Wales Government, receiving funding through Create NSW, and also federal government through the Australia Council.

The 51-hectare (130-acre) Eveleigh Rail Complex Yards were built on the site between 1880 and 1889 and the decommissioned
913: 829: 252:. Carriageworks successfully emerged from voluntary administration and reopened its doors to the public in August 2020. 2325: 1224: 300: 424:
Carriageworks successfully emerged from voluntary administration and reopened its doors to the public in August 2020.

Between 2012 and 2018, Carriageworks only made a profit in one year. In 2018, the centre obtained
